Hey guys,  I'm new to the (real) lightsaber scene.  After a while using the (horrible) wal-mart lightsabers, I'm finally gonna get something more real.  Anyways, I have a few questions regarding the blade types.

1) What is the difference between the mid grade and the heavy grade blades?  I'm assuming it's to do with the strength, but I'm not sure.

2) What exactly the UltraEdge option?  And if I got the heavy blade, should I get UltraEdge as well, since they're the same price?

The heavy grade blade is just a thicker blade used for dueling purposes. The Ultraedge blade is made of a white polycarbonate for a fuller brighter look. You'll have to look at some comparisons that people have posted on here to choose which you would like personally. Everyone has their own opinions. It depends on the color. Be warned that Ultra Edge changes the color slightly. UE makes the blue a lighter blue that's closer to the blue in ROTS, where as in the standard blade it's a darker blu like in TPM/AOTC. With green UE makes a mintier color green and standard gives you more of a "movie green." I've also heard the orange looks better in standard as well. Regardless of color, the UE makes the blade look fuller. Some people don't like it but I prefer it.

For the most part, the Ultraedge and regular grade blades will depend on what you like. The regular grade does have a burst effect and is a little brighter, but, the Ultraedge does have a constant even effect. I like the regular grade personally. The orange looks more of a yellow in it I think, but I think that is great. The bright colors will be bright, and the red will look a little different. Dueling wise, if you are going to be doing heavy dueling, get a heavy grade of either blade. If you are new to it, then just go with a regular grade blade. Keep in mind, the heavy grade is heavier *literally* so if you are not used to swinging a saber around, it may give you a work out. The length also varies on what you like as well, if the 36" blade is too much, just ask Ultra about it.
